New information tells us that mining a single Bitcoin or one BTC prices the most important public mining corporations over $82,000 USD, which is sort of double the determine it did the earlier quarter. Estimates for smaller organisations say it’s worthwhile to spend about $137,000 to get that single BTC in return. BTC is at present solely valued at $94,703 USD, which appears to be an issue within the math division.
These prices may even worsen relying on the nation you are doing all your mining. Germany is usually thought-about to be one of many worst locations to mine BTC from a revenue perspective. It prices round $200,000 USD to mine a single coin there.
So why would anybody be mining BTC nowadays? Properly the principle cause, aside from maybe dim hopes that they’re going to strike it wealthy, is about expertise. At the moment optimising farms to mine quicker on decrease energy has been the aim. Plus searching for out locations the place electrical energy is cheaper to attempt to maximise these good points.
As soon as you have received these extremely environment friendly, and hopefully comparatively energy pleasant setups in place, you have not solely dropped your potential mining overheads however you possible have a computation setup that would full different duties. This makes it a beautiful choice for bigger corporations who could look to lease their mining operations for different computations after they’re unable to earn money from mining. Then they’ll swap again if and when the market picks up as soon as once more.
